I will offer up some general advice (as I would like to turn everything into a positive).
-Good elk hunters and callers very rarely brag about their skills.
-The internet is a great resource and I always listen to what other people have to say (and later decipher what I think is true or relevant). It doesn't help you when you blow off advice and it doesnt hurt to listen without opening your mouth (sometimes a boot is the perfect fit).
-The day I quit wanting to learn stuff from other elk hunters and situations is the day I cut myself short. I have actually learned a lot from rookie hunters who have tried stuff that is out of the box and has worked. I always throw that in the bag of tricks, just in case.
-Don't come on the internet and claim to have done something you haven't. You have just lost all your credibility and it will be tough to get back.
As far as calling elk, it can be done with a hoochie mama, primos external and the terminator (in my mind thay would be equivalent to going to war with nothing but hand grenades and expecting to win). Calls are just one small aspect. The right call at the right time, setup and other factors along with quality calling is what matters.
I would say continue to research the unit, scout, practice your calling and TAKE advice from anyone willing to give it. Bye the way I hope your ol man smacks a good bull in there.
